Product Introduction

Overview

The NB6N14SMNGEVB is an evaluation board designed by ON Semiconductor for the NB6N14S high-speed clock fanout buffer and translator IC. This board provides a flexible and convenient platform to evaluate, characterize, and verify the operation of the NB6N14S device. The evaluation board is part of the ECLinPS MAX™ family of high-performance products and is intended to support the development and testing of high-frequency clock distribution networks, communication equipment, and data transfer systems.

Key Specifications

Parameter Value Description
Manufacturer ON Semiconductor
Device Type Clock Fanout Buffer and Translator
Input Types CML, LVDS, LVPECL AnyLevel™ input compatibility
Input:Output Ratio 1:4
Maximum Input Clock Frequency 2.0 GHz
Maximum Input Data Rate 2.5 Gb/s
Package Type 16-QFN (3x3) Exposed Pad
Operating Temperature -40°C to 85°C
Voltage Supply 3 V ~ 3.6 V
Mounting Type Surface Mount
Moisture Sensitivity Level (MSL) 1 (Unlimited)
Lead Free Status / RoHS Status Lead free / RoHS Compliant

Key Features

  • ECLinPS MAX™ technology for high-performance clock distribution
  • AnyLevel™ input compatibility with CML, LVDS, and LVPECL signals
  • 1-to-4 fanout buffer and translator functionality
  • High frequency performance up to 2 GHz and 2.5 Gb/s data rate
  • Differential input/output with low noise and skew
  • VREF_AC reference output and TIA/EIA-644 compliance
  • Functionally compatible with existing 3.3 V LVEL, LVEP, EP, and SG devices
  • Pb-free and RoHS compliant package

Applications

  • High-frequency clock distribution networks
  • Communication equipment
  • Data transfer systems
  • SONET, GigE, Fiber Channel, and Backplane applications
